Seems a common Ranger issue,,, wipers work only work on high, and when turned off they do not cycle through and rest correctly. This 93 Splash does all that,,,, replaced steering column multi-switch,,,, have new motor assembly,,,, did not install it, but connected it ,,,,it works the same as one in truck,,, high only,,,,, No relays in electric dist. box next to battery,,, no relay on steering column,, or nearby,,,,,,,,,,, ???? where is a relay or control module for a 93 Splash ??????
 






If it's in the same location as the Explorer,
The relay box for the wipers is crammed nicely up in about the center of the dash. It could be a little grey or black box. There is a little circuit board in it, with a relay soldered on it, and one or more of the solder joints will crack and you'll have to re-solder the joints. Then it will work as good as new!

I have done this a couple times, once for me and once for a friend.

Sorry my answer is fairly vague, but the job is really easy, and I think you'll get it! The hardest part is taking the relay box out, (It's really crammed in there!)
 






well, thanks for the reply,,, it seems the wiper module on this 93 Splash, was above the brake/gas pedal, there are two modules there,,, my mechanic friend wiggled the wires on the connector on one module and wipers worked fine,,,, he said he sorta' pushed the wire into the connector,,, so,, module is fine,,, connector was mis-behaivng,,, his fix could last hours or years,,,,, will have to see,,,,,,,,,,,
